How Our Water Damage Repair Process Works
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. From the initial assessment to the final cleanup, we’ll keep you informed every step of the way. Our process includes:
Assessment and Inspection
We’ll arrive at your property and conduct a thorough assessment to identify the source and extent of the water dam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the structural integrity of your property.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action to take.
Water Extraction and Removal
Once we’ve identified the affected areas, our team will use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the water. We’ll also remove any dam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and insulation, to prevent further damage.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out the affected areas.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and structural damage. Our technicians will monitor the drying process to ensure that your property is completely dry and safe.
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the drying process is complete, our team will cl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ure that your property is safe and healthy.
Reconstruction and Repair
Finally, we’ll reconstruct and repair any dam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ians will work with you to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Repair
Water damage can be sneaky, and it’s essential to catch the signs early on to prevent costly repairs.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your property, it’s time to call a professional to investigate.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Stains and Discoloration
Stains and discoloration on walls, ceilings, and floors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your walls, it’s time to call a professional to investigate.
Water Stains on Ceilings
Water stains on ceilings can be a sign of a roof leak or burst pipe.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your property,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Water Damage Repair Cost In Woodstock, GA
The cost of water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odstock, GA. Here are some estimates for common water damage repair services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Structural dr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ment used.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used. |
| Reconstruction and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of materials used. |

Common Questions About Water Damage Repair
Q: How long does water damage repair take?
A: The length of time it takes to repair water damage dep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ks to complete the repairs. Our team will work with you to establish a timeline that suits your needs.
Q: Is water damage repair covered by insurance?
A: In most cases, yes. Water damage repair is typically covered by homeowners ins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and the circumstances of the damage. Our team will work with you to navigate the insurance process and ensure that you receive the coverage you need.
Q: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?
A: Yes. There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age, including regular maintenance of your plumbing system, checking for leaks, and installing a sump pump or water sensor. Our team can also provide you with recommendations for preventing water damage in the future.
Q: What happens if I ignore water damage?
A: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s, mold growth, and structural damage.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and ensure the safety of your property.
